Thousands of people gathered in Bern on Saturday afternoon to demonstrate for higher wages. They responded to a call from the Swiss Federation of Trade Unions (SGB) and the associations of Travailsuisse, the umbrella organization for employees.

The demands focused on wage increases of up to five percent, according to a statement. The unions denounced the fact that real wages are below the 2019 level despite generally good economic development.

A parade was planned from Schützenmatte, not far from the station, to Bundesplatz, where a final rally with speeches was on the program. Shortly before the planned start at 2 p.m., several thousand people had gathered at the meeting point.

The Bern cantonal police expected major traffic restrictions in the city center until 5 p.m., as they announced in advance. They also announced that they would be deployed with an "appropriate disposition".
